How they compare
Seychelles currently reports 6,658 against 6,268 in Marshall Islands, a difference of 390.
That makes Seychelles's figure about 1.1 times Marshall Islands's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 8 shared years of data; in 1998 it was Seychelles ahead.
Marshall Islands ranks 186th and Seychelles ranks 183rd of 191 countries.
Seychelles has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
